Onboarding note for the Ledgerpane admin table: bulk edits are applied through the batcher service, not directly against the database. Select rows, choose an action, and the batcher stages changes in a pending set you can review before commit. Edits over 500 rows require a second approver — this is enforced server-side, so don't try to chunk around it. To run the batcher locally you need the staging write credential, which goes in your .env as the next line.

secret setting of bahip-kagag: RELAY_SECRET3=c83

## Sensor drift: what to do at 3am

If the GrowLoop controller starts reporting humidity swings that don't match the backup probes in the Fernwick greenhouse, it's almost always sensor drift, not an actual climate event. Don't panic and don't touch the vents manually. First, restart the calibration daemon and give it ten minutes to re-baseline. If readings still disagree by more than 5%, flip the controller into safe mode. The safe-mode thresholds it will use are these.

config for yahap-bajof:
[istix]
host = istix.qorvelsys.internal
user = istix_svc
database = istix_prod

## ParcelPing Webhooks — Setup

ParcelPing pushes parcel-status events to your plugin endpoint. Run the local relay to receive test events. Copy env.example to .env. Set WEBHOOK_PORT=9090 and EVENT_FILTER=delivered,exception. Retries: three attempts, exponential backoff, no config needed. Payloads are JSON; schemas live in /docs. The relay signs every event, and verification requires the shared secret, set on the following line.

vault entry, yajop-bafop: ARCHIVE_KEY3=8d4

Because worker pools are shared across plugins, any blocking work you do directly reduces batch throughput for everyone downstream. Prefer async I/O, and respect the per-batch memory ceiling rather than buffering whole directories. These values were chosen after profiling on the Verlano build farm with mixed JPEG/PNG workloads; override them only via the documented flags, never by patching internals. The defaults we ship are as follows.

tuning constants:
QUOTAS = {
    "druwyn": 5,
    "holix": 5,
    "zorath": 5,
    "holwyn": 10,
}